No. of questions – 15 WebThe present research proposes that empathic concern, as assessed by six items of the ERQ, consists of two separate emotions, i.e., tenderness and sympathy. To test this assumption, nine studies were conducted among, in total, 1,273 participants. Estimated time: 4 mins. WebThe Power of Sympathy Themes. The Power of Sympathy's main themes are the dangers of seduction and the importance of women's morality. The Dangers of Seduction. In many instances throughout the novel, seduction and sexuality lead to death. Ophelia, Maria, Harriot, and Thomas all ultimately die because they allowed themselves to be swept away …

WebApr 23, 2024 · Empathy allows us to relate to and understand the feelings of others – which is a great social skill. It allows us to build strong connections with those around us and look after those in need. Empathy is a pro-social skill – a skill which benefits other people.
